How to Convert Ccf to Homer (Biblical)
1 ccf = 12.8712939090909 homer
Example: convert 15 ccf to homer:
15 ccf = 15 Γ 12.8712939090909 homer = 193.069408636364 homer

Ccf
A ccf (hundred cubic feet) is a unit of volume commonly used in the measurement of natural gas and water, equivalent to 100 cubic feet.
History/Origin
The ccf originated in the early 20th century as a practical unit for measuring natural gas and water consumption, especially in the United States, to simplify billing and volume calculations.
Current Use
Today, the ccf is primarily used in the utility industry for billing natural gas and water services, and it remains a standard unit in the United States for these measurements.
Homer (Biblical)
The homer is an ancient biblical unit of volume used to measure dry commodities, approximately equivalent to 6 bushels or about 220 liters.
History/Origin
The homer originates from biblical times and was used in ancient Israel for measuring grain and other dry goods. It is mentioned in the Old Testament and reflects the measurement practices of that era.
Current Use
The homer is largely obsolete today and is primarily of historical and biblical interest. It is occasionally referenced in scholarly studies of ancient measurements but is not used in modern measurement systems.
